what is the approximate volume of a tree trunk if the trunk is 12 feet tall with a circumference of 4.5 feet

1. The tree trunk has the shape of a cylinder

2. The volume of a cylinder is base area*height.

3. Volume=
\pi r^(2) *h . We have the height, and we need the radius, which can be found using the circumference formula.

4. Circumference =
2 \pi r


4.5=2 \pi r


r=(4.5)/(2 \pi ) (feet)

5.
V=\pi r^(2) *h= \pi ((4.5)/(2 \pi ))^(2)*12= \pi (20.25)/( 4 \pi ^(2))*12= (20.25*3)/(\pi)

with
\pi approximately equal to 3.14,


V= (20.25*3)/(3.14)=19.35 (feet cubed)
